Choosing the Right Brush to Paint Furniture: A Buying Guide
Painting furniture is a great way to refresh old pieces. A good paintbrush makes a big difference in how your project looks. This guide will help you pick the best brush for painting your furniture.
Key Features to Look For
When you shop for a paint brush, look closely at these parts.
- **Bristle Type:** This is the most important choice. Natural bristles work best with oil-based paints. Synthetic bristles (nylon or polyester) are better for water-based paints like latex or acrylic.
- **Bristle Shape:** Brushes come in flat or angled shapes. Flat brushes cover large, flat areas fast. Angled brushes help you get into corners and edges neatly.
- **Ferrule:** This is the metal band that holds the bristles to the handle. A strong, rust-proof ferrule means the bristles stay put. A weak one lets bristles fall out onto your furniture.
- **Handle Comfort:** You will hold the brush for a while. A comfortable handle reduces hand tiredness. Look for a handle that feels good in your grip.
Important Materials Matter
The materials used in the brush affect how smoothly the paint goes on.
Bristle Material
If you use latex paint (the most common for furniture), choose **synthetic bristles**. They hold water-based paint well and clean up easily with soap and water. If you use oil-based primer or paint, use **natural hog hair bristles**. Natural bristles do not absorb water, so they keep their shape when using oil products.
Handle Material
Most good furniture brushes have wooden handles. Wood feels natural and gives you good control. Some handles are plastic or rubberized. These can offer better grip, especially if your hands get messy.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Not all brushes paint the same. Quality matters for a smooth finish.
What Makes a Brush Better?
High-quality brushes use “flagged” bristles. This means the tips of the bristles are split, like tiny flags. These splits hold more paint and spread it more evenly. Better brushes also use stainless steel or nickel-plated ferrules that resist rust.
What Makes a Brush Worse?
Cheap brushes often use uneven, stiff bristles. These brushes leave lots of visible brush strokes on your furniture. If the ferrule is thin metal, it might loosen quickly. Also, brushes that shed a lot of bristles into the paint ruin the smooth look you want.
User Experience and Use Cases
Think about what you are painting. This will guide your final choice.
For Large, Flat Surfaces (Tabletops, Dresser Sides):
Use a **2-inch or 2.5-inch flat brush**. This size covers ground quickly. You want a brush with soft, flexible synthetic bristles if using modern furniture paint.
For Detailed Work (Chair Legs, Edges, Trim):
Use a **1-inch or 1.5-inch angled sash brush**. The angle lets you cut a straight line right where the edge meets the flat surface. This gives you crisp, clean lines.
For Chalk Paint or Distress Finish:
If you use chalk paint, many people like **natural bristle brushes** because they help create a slightly textured, rustic look. However, synthetic brushes work fine too if you prefer a smoother finish.

10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About Paint Brushes for Furniture
Q: Should I use natural or synthetic bristles for latex paint?
A: Always use **synthetic bristles** (nylon/polyester) for water-based latex or acrylic paints. Natural bristles get soggy with water.
Q: What is the best brush size for painting a small side table?
A: A **1.5-inch or 2-inch flat brush** works well for most small furniture pieces. It is big enough for speed but small enough for control.
Q: How do I stop the brush from leaving streaks?
A: Use a good quality brush with flagged tips. Apply paint in thin, even coats. Brush slowly, and try to finish your strokes in the same direction.
Q: Is an angled brush necessary for painting cabinets?
A: An angled brush is very helpful for cabinets. It helps you paint the inside corners of the frames neatly without getting paint on the edges.
Q: How should I clean an oil-based paint brush?
A: Clean oil-based brushes using mineral spirits or paint thinner, then wash with soap and water. Never use only water.
Q: What does “flagged bristles” mean?
A: Flagged bristles have split ends. These splits hold more paint and help the brush lay the paint down smoothly, reducing brush marks.
Q: Can I reuse a cheap, disposable brush?
A: You can reuse a cheap brush if you clean it very well right after use. However, cheap brushes break down faster and usually leave a worse finish.
Q: What is the ferrule, and why does it matter?
A: The ferrule is the metal band holding the bristles. If it is weak or rusty, the bristles will fall out into your paint job.
Q: Should I soak my new brush before painting?
A: If using **synthetic bristles** with water-based paint, you can briefly dip the bristles (but not the ferrule) in water first. This helps them soften up.
Q: What is the best way to store my good paint brushes?
A: After cleaning and drying, store them hanging up or lying flat. Keep the bristles pointing up if stored in a container, to keep their shape.
